Director of Public Relations

J Public Relations
Posted: 11/17/11

J Public Relations' San Diego office is accepting applications for a Director of Publicity. As our office continues to rapidly grow, we’re looking for the “right” candidate, with a strong work ethic, to work on top luxury hospitality and culinary accounts. The ideal candidate should be an enthusiastic PR professional with a proven track record handling high-end travel, hospitality, and lifestyle accounts and for providing clients with top-tier media results locally, regionally and nationally. Considered candidates must be extremely connected with the regional and national media landscape (print, online, broadcast) with a specific focus on travel, culinary, consumer and lifestyle. Candidate must also be an engaged participant in various social media platforms and have experience utilizing these platforms to help generate awareness for clients.

Our ideal Director of Publicity candidate will:

Have a minimum of 7-10 years experience executing effective PR campaigns in the hospitality, culinary, travel, tourism, restaurant and consumer lifestyle arenas, either having worked in an agency or in-house position.

Must have stellar current national hospitality, travel, restaurant, and lifestyle media contacts and references.

Must have extensive experience managing a team consisting of senior and junior level staff members

Must thrive in a collaborative, fast-paced environment

Must possess a passion for seeking out what’s new and notable in the industries we serve

Must be well versed in managing day to day client relations

Must be able to demonstrate past secured press placements and specific account successes

Must have experience coordinating (and attending) press trips for luxury accounts/brands.

Demonstrate a strong understanding of the evolving social media landscape and its impact on PR in addition to familiarity working with online media outlets and managing blogger relations.

Excellent verbal and written skills a must, a creative approach key.

Experience participating in new business pitching.

Possess a personal passion for a job well done.

Believe that hard work will be rewarded and is looking for an agency that believes it too.
